Chromium Code Reviews| Index: chrome/browser/metrics/chrome_metrics_service_client.cc |
| diff --git a/chrome/browser/metrics/chrome_metrics_service_client.cc b/chrome/browser/metrics/chrome_metrics_service_client.cc |
| index 8954197117c9b35a4d1ba0d4a5d44bf6d59bf963..095a2c3e8d44dbfd28ddc956471377f57979dd39 100644 |
| --- a/chrome/browser/metrics/chrome_metrics_service_client.cc |
| +++ b/chrome/browser/metrics/chrome_metrics_service_client.cc |
| @@ -21,6 +21,7 @@ |
| #include "chrome/browser/browser_process.h" |
| #include "chrome/browser/chrome_notification_types.h" |
| #include "chrome/browser/google/google_brand.h" |
| +#include "chrome/browser/metrics/call_stack_profile_metrics_provider.h" |
| #include "chrome/browser/metrics/chrome_stability_metrics_provider.h" |
| #include "chrome/browser/metrics/omnibox_metrics_provider.h" |
| #include "chrome/browser/ui/browser_otr_state.h" |
| @@ -293,6 +294,11 @@ void ChromeMetricsServiceClient::Initialize() { |
| metrics_service_->RegisterMetricsProvider( |
| scoped_ptr<metrics::MetricsProvider>(profiler_metrics_provider_)); |
| + call_stack_profile_metrics_provider_ = new CallStackProfileMetricsProvider; |
|
Ilya Sherman
2015/03/10 01:44:46
I don't see any reason to cache this pointer (nor
Mike Wittman
2015/03/16 23:55:15
No, removed.
|
| + metrics_service_->RegisterMetricsProvider( |
| + scoped_ptr<metrics::MetricsProvider>( |
| + call_stack_profile_metrics_provider_)); |
| + |
| #if defined(OS_ANDROID) |
| metrics_service_->RegisterMetricsProvider( |
| scoped_ptr<metrics::MetricsProvider>( |